Subject: Quickstore 4.2 — bloom filter now fronts the KV layer

Plugin authors: starting with this release, Quickstore places a bloom filter ahead of the key-value store. Negative lookups return faster; false positives fall through safely. No API changes are required on your side. Verify your plugin against the staging build referenced below.

session token of fahif-tadup = htk3_9c7

### Migrating Cron Jobs to Harborloom

We are moving all scheduled tasks from host-level cron into the Harborloom workflow engine. New jobs must be defined as Harborloom workflows; do not add crontab entries. Existing jobs are being migrated team by team per the tracker. If your team's jobs are not yet scheduled for migration, contact the platform group at the address below.

alerts address for kajog-tadup: druox@plorvanet.internal

Sort in `buildSummaryRows` isn't stable — ties on revenue reorder between runs, which breaks the Marwick snapshot diffs. Switch to the stable sort helper and add the secondary key on row id. Also cap the comparator depth; deep tie-breaking was the perf problem last quarter. The caps we settled on are the constants below.

limits module of fajog-tawig:
RATE_LIMITS = {
    "druwyn": 2,
    "quenael": 10,
    "wenix": 2,
    "druael": 2,
}